Output 73b24a6d815ad170dee2e1ce649a7aad541f12132df302da925e3a27e457ff70:19

value
86000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a7401d5855dfc3e59c2768065cbe02622f75749 OP_EQUAL
address
3CrVLGPaWW76Pvb3vfAiQJr1cQDHkedbYz
transaction
73b24a6d815ad170dee2e1ce649a7aad541f12132df302da925e3a27e457ff70
spent
true